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Ismael's Broad-nosed Bat | White-lined Tanager |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Thraupidae |
| Genus | Platyrrhinus | Tachyphonus |
| Species | Platyrrhinus ismaeli | Tachyphonus rufus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Ismael's Broad-nosed Bat and White-lined Tanager share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
